This research paper, part of the World Resources Report 2013-14 series, analyzes the economic and environmental impacts of global food loss and waste and proposes that halving these losses by 2050 could significantly bridge the gap in future global food requirements.

  • Approximately 24 percent of all calories produced for human consumption are lost or wasted, which means one in four food calories intended for people is not consumed. This differs from the Food and Agriculture Organization of the United Nations (FAO) 2009 estimate of 32 percent, which was based on weight rather than calories.
  • Food loss and waste result in negative economic consequences, such as reduced farmer incomes and increased consumer costs, and environmental damage, including inefficient land and water use and unnecessary greenhouse gas emissions.
  • Reducing the current rate of food loss and waste from 24 percent to 12 percent by 2050 would reduce the world's annual food need by approximately 1,314 trillion kilocalories (kcal). This reduction represents roughly 22 percent of the 6,000 trillion kcal annual gap between current food availability and the needs of 2050.
